Grant Opportunity Analysis

The Health Resources and Services Administration (HRSA) is offering a funding opportunity through the Rural Health Clinic Technical Assistance Program, aimed at providing technical assistance to Rural Health Clinics (RHCs). The program seeks to identify and address key policy, regulatory, and clinical issues impacting RHCs, while also disseminating valuable resources and strategies to enhance healthcare delivery in rural areas. With an estimated total program funding of $110,000 and a single award anticipated, interested domestic organizations are encouraged to apply, with applications due by April 17, 2026. Additional Eligibility Information

Only domestic organizations are eligible. "Domestic" means the 50 states, the District of Columbia, the Commonwealth of Puerto Rico, the Northern Mariana Islands, American Samoa, Guam, the U.S. Virgin Islands, the Federated States of Micronesia, the Republic of the Marshall Islands, and the Republic of Palau.
